The Director of Media and Public Relations shapes and executes strategies to promote the Reporters Committee in the media and among core audiences. The ideal candidate is a strategic communicator who can navigate the intersection of media law and journalism.The Director of Media and PR is skilled at securing top-tier coverage and building relationships with national, local, legal, and media reporters. They drive proactive and rapid-response media strategy, working closely with the Legal and Policy teams to pitch and promote the organization, its work, and its spokespeople.
